Code : 1YLZ   PDBj   RCSB PDB   PDBe
Header : HYDROLASE
Title : X-ray crystallographic structure of CTX-M-14 beta-lactamase complexed with ceftazidime-like boronic acid
Release Data : 2005-04-26
Compound :
mol_id molecule chains
1 BETA-LACTAMASE CTX-M-14 A,B
ec: 3.5.2.6
Source :
mol_id organism_scientific expression_system
1 Escherichia coli  (taxid:562) Escherichia coli BL21(DE3)  (taxid:469008)
gene: CTX-M
expression_system_strain: BL21(DE3)
expression_system_vector_type: plasmid
expression_system_plasmid: pET-9a
Authors : Chen, Y., Shoichet, B., Bonnet, R.
Keywords : CTX-M, beta-lactamase, transition state, ceftazidime, boronic acid, HYDROLASE
Exp. method : X-RAY DIFFRACTION ( 1.35 Å )
Citation :

Structure, Function, and Inhibition along the Reaction Coordinate of CTX-M beta-Lactamases.

Chen, Y.,Shoichet, B.,Bonnet, R.
(2005)  J.Am.Chem.Soc.  127 : 5423 - 5434

PubMed: 15826180
DOI: 10.1021/ja042850a
